What is OCEAN Coin-margined Contract

An OCEAN coin-margined contract is a perpetual futures agreement where Ocean Protocol tokens serve as the sole collateral and settlement asset. Traders deposit OCEAN to open leveraged positions, with profits and losses calculated in OCEAN rather than USDT or other stablecoins. Major exchanges like Binance and Bybit offer these instruments, allowing direct exposure to OCEAN price action while maintaining token-denominated holdings. The perpetual structure means no expiration date, replacing traditional futures with funding rate payments.

How OCEAN Coin-margined Contract Works

The contract operates through a leverage mechanism where position size exceeds the deposited margin.

Core Calculation Structure:

1. Position Value:
Position Value = Number of Contracts × Entry Price

2. Margin Requirement:
Required Margin = Position Value ÷ Leverage Multiplier

3. Unrealized PnL:
PnL = (Exit Price – Entry Price) × Contract Size

4. Funding Rate Settlement (every 8 hours):
Funding Payment = Position Value × Current Funding Rate

The funding rate balances long and short positions, typically ranging between -0.03% to +0.03% based on interest rate differentials. When funding is positive, long holders pay short holders; negative funding reverses the flow. This mechanism maintains price convergence with spot markets, as referenced in Binance’s perpetual contract documentation.

Risks and Limitations

Coin-margined contracts carry amplified downside risks during cryptocurrency volatility. A 20% adverse price movement wipes out a 5x leveraged position entirely, with forced liquidation triggering additional fees. OCEAN’s relatively lower market capitalization compared to Bitcoin or Ethereum means wider bid-ask spreads and reduced liquidity during stress events. The Bank for International Settlements (BIS) warns that leverage in crypto derivatives creates systemic vulnerabilities when correlated positions face simultaneous liquidation. Regulatory uncertainty around Ocean Protocol’s data tokenization model adds policy risk that could impact long-term contract viability.

OCEAN Coin-margined vs USDT-margined Contracts

Understanding distinctions prevents costly execution errors. USDT-margined contracts settle profits and losses in stablecoins, providing certainty about dollar-denominated returns but requiring conversion for crypto-native strategies. Coin-margined variants like OCEAN contracts keep traders fully immersed in token exposure, beneficial when anticipating sustained appreciation but catastrophic during downturns. Margin calculation differs fundamentally: USDT contracts calculate margin in stablecoins while OCEAN contracts value collateral in fluctuating tokens, creating compounding exposure effects. Funding rate expectations also diverge, as coin-margined products typically exhibit different rate structures reflecting distinct market dynamics.
